All the details on #KFCCouple’s New Year’s Eve wedding

The now-famous KFC Couple will be married on New Year’s Eve and with all due respect to every celebrity in Mzansi, their wedding is the most highly-anticipated ceremony of the year! When Hector Mkansi went down on one knee and proposed to the love of his life, Nonhlanhla Soldaat, we don’t think he could have possibly imagined how things were going to pan out. His marriage proposal, which took place in a KFC restaurant, was captured on video and within hours had gone viral. Exciting as this was, it was not the end of their growing popularity.

Inspired by their love story, some of the biggest brands in South Africa took a moment to pledge their support in order to make the wedding a reality. Before we knew it, their entire wedding had been sponsored by brands such as Coca Cola, Kulula, Sun City Resort, Siwela Wines, Castle Lite, Audi, Tsogo Sun, Puma and Huawei.

This week, we received word for the first time that the couple’s wedding date had been confirmed. They will be tying the knot on the 31st of December 2019 and we expect a massive guest list for their big day.

In other news – Busiswa’s documentary to debut at Africa Rising International Film Festival next week

Busiswa An Unbreakable Story’ will kick off this year’s proceedings at the festival.
If you’ve ever wondered about the origins of one of Africa’s biggest Gqom sensations, Busiswa Gqulu, you’re about to have all your questions answered when Busiswa: An Unbreakable Story debuts at Africa Rising International Film Festival next week.

Busiswa: An Unbreakable Story is a Can Do! film directed by Fred Kayembe and Vaughn Thiel that promises to take us on a journey back in time to explore the complex conditions that thrust a modest young girl from Umtata into the spotlight as a boisterous voice that reverberates through our speakers alongside Beyonce Knowles on The Gift.
